Mini excavators for sale
Mini excavators are small excavators designed for tasks in tight spaces, making them indispensable on urban construction sites, landscaping jobs, and small-scale agricultural projects. Also known as mini diggers or compact excavators, these machines deliver precision and efficiency where larger equipment cannot operate. Their reduced weight and size allow for easier transport and minimal ground impact, making them an excellent second hand solution for professionals looking for maneuverable yet capable excavation tools. Depending on the task, both new and used mini excavators offer versatility for trenching, grading, demolition, and utility work.
Key Aspects to Consider When Choosing Machinery
When evaluating small excavators, professionals prioritize specific features that affect performance and adaptability:
- Engine Power and Efficiency: A balanced engine ensures adequate digging force while keeping fuel consumption low—important when managing long-term project costs.
- Operating Weight: Lightweight machines allow for easier relocation and access to narrow spaces, while slightly heavier ones provide added lifting power and ground stability.
- Digging Depth and Reach: Mini equipment typically offers a digging depth of 2.5–4 meters, suitable for pipelines, landscaping, and foundation work.
- Hydraulic Flow and Pressure: A high-performance hydraulic system improves attachment responsiveness and operating speed, enhancing productivity in complex jobs.
- Attachment Compatibility: With the right tools—buckets, augers, breakers—a compact excavator becomes a multi-functional asset for various excavation tasks.
Operator Requirements and EU Licensing for Mini Diggers
Operators of compact excavators in the EU must undergo certified training, which combines practical and theoretical instruction. Health and safety certification is also essential, particularly for those working on construction sites. Whether buying a new or used machine, verifying that operators comply with local certification standards is critical for legal and safe use.

Prices
Typically, Mini excavators range in price from $10,000 to $50,000, depending on various factors. The key determinants include the machine's age, size, operational hours, and the overall condition. Additional features, such as attachments and the manufacturer's brand, can also significantly influence the price.

FAQ
What are the advantages of using a compact excavator over a standard one?
Compact excavators offer greater mobility and access in restricted areas, lower transport costs, and reduced ground damage—ideal for residential and urban projects.
Are mini diggers suitable for professional use in landscaping and utilities?
Yes, mini diggers are widely used by professionals in landscaping, utility trenching, and small construction due to their precision and compatibility with various attachments.
